    The Venezuelan National Electoral Council (CNE) is the governing body responsible for overseeing all electoral processes in the country. Established to ensure transparency, fairness, and accuracy in elections, the CNE provides voters with the tools they need to participate fully in the democratic process.

    Key Responsibilities of the CNE:

    • Managing voter registration and updates
    • Providing polling station locations
    • Ensuring compliance with electoral laws
    • Facilitating the voting process for all eligible citizens

    Through its online portal, the CNE allows citizens to verify their voting information, including polling station details and registration status, using their cédula de identidad. This ensures that every voter has access to accurate and up-to-date information.

    Steps to Verify Your Information:

    To check your voting information by ID number, follow these simple steps:

    1. Visit the official CNE website.
    2. Locate the "Consulta de Datos Electorales" section.
    3. Enter your cédula de identidad number in the designated field.
    4. Submit the request and review the results.

    Remember, only the official CNE portal should be used for this process to ensure data security and accuracy.

    Understanding the Results: What to Look For

    When reviewing the results of your CNE query, pay attention to the following key details:

    • Voting Status: Confirm whether you're registered to vote.
    • Polling Station: Note the location and address of your assigned polling station.
    • Voting District: Understand which district you belong to for election purposes.

    If any of this information seems incorrect or outdated, you can initiate the necessary updates through the CNE portal or contact their support team.

    Common Issues and How to Resolve Them

    Incorrect Polling Station Information

    If your polling station information appears incorrect, contact the CNE directly to report the issue. Provide your cédula de identidad and any supporting documents to facilitate the correction process.

    Registration Errors

    In the event of registration errors, such as missing or outdated information, visit the nearest CNE office to update your records. Bring all required documentation to expedite the process.

    Troubleshooting Technical Issues

    Technical issues, such as website downtime or connection problems, can sometimes hinder access to the CNE portal. In such cases, try accessing the site during off-peak hours or contact the CNE support team for assistance.
